Black Bear Cove RV Park
5842 Hwy 30.
Benton, TN 37307
http://www.blackbearcove.com/rvparkmain.aspx

Black Bear Cove RV Park is located on the banks of the beautiful scenic Hiwassee River, in a secluded valley adjacent to US Highway 411 and is open year-round.
The rv park consists of 41 beautiful sites with views of the Chilhowee and Starr Mountains as well as the Gee Creek Wilderness Area. Guests can fish the Hiwassee River from the campground property or take a walk through the beautiful 50 acre Black Bear Cove grounds.
